As of April 21, 2026, the Zacks consensus forecast for ONEOK’s Q1 2026 results stands at adjusted EPS of $1.30, representing a 25% YoY increase from the $1.04 per share reported in Q1 2025. Consensus revenue for the quarter is projected at $9.52 billion, an 18.3% YoY rise from the year-ago period’s $8.05 billion top line. Expert Insights

From a quantitative earnings prediction perspective, the combination of ONEOK’s -1.84% Earnings ESP and Zacks Rank 3 (Hold) means the stock does not qualify as a high-conviction earnings beat candidate, per Zacks Investment Research’s proprietary model. The framework, which boasts a 70% success rate in predicting positive EPS surprises for stocks with a positive ESP and Zacks Rank 1 (Strong Buy) to 3 (Hold), offers no statistically significant predictive power for stocks with negative ESP readings, as is the case for ONEOK here. It is critical to note that a negative ESP does not indicate a guaranteed earnings miss, only that there is insufficient recent positive analyst revision data to support a bullish surprise call. Fundamentally, ONEOK’s underlying business remains strong, even if near-term earnings results are mixed. The firm’s asset footprint across the Permian, Bakken and Mid-Continent basins positions it to capture continued growth in U.S. natural gas production, which the U.S. Energy Information Administration projects will rise 3.2% in 2026 to a record 106.7 billion cubic feet per day. Investors should prioritize three key details from the upcoming earnings call over headline EPS results: management’s update on the $1.2 billion Gulf Coast Express 2 pipeline expansion, which is scheduled to enter service in Q4 2026 and is expected to add $380 million in annual EBITDA starting 2027; any adjustments to full-year 2026 capital expenditure guidance, which is currently set at $3.2 billion; and updates to the firm’s dividend policy, after it raised its quarterly payout 5% in January 2026 to $1.06 per share, giving it a 5.1% forward dividend yield. ONEOK currently trades at 12.2x 2026 consensus adjusted EPS, a 10% discount to its peer group average of 13.5x, suggesting limited downside risk even if the firm misses consensus estimates. For existing investors, holding the stock ahead of earnings is justified by its strong long-term cash flow visibility and attractive income profile.
